Let me walk you down memory lane so you understand what crazy mfrs you are dealing with. Here's my list of all @JirasanOfficial launches and my ratings for them. GEN1 [?/10]: I was not there for it, but it couldn't get any better when you talk about an OG NFT collection. Retro pixel art, small supply, great founders @jamkaa_mgl and @shanicucic96 made history with a 0.05 ETH mint price to 23 ETH ATH... GEN2 [7/10]: Getting whitelisted for this collection with 3333 supply was fucking hard. I remember being euphoric when my wallet was whitelisted for being a Chad in the @AscendedOasis discord (thanks, @Swaggerstallion). The mint price was 0.2. It went to 2ETH pre-reveal, and the community liked the art. Gen 2's ran to 7ETH ATH... $JIRA [7/10]: @shanicucic96 was the first to discuss a marketplace selling WLs with erc20 tokens generated by staking NFTs. Ramo allegedly stole the idea for Habibiz (I know, right), but PG made its version of the marketplace. At a certain point, the $JIRA token was trading at crazy valuations ($200$ worth of $JIRA per day per NFT). FUSION [5/10]: A crazy idea of fusing two existing GEN2s to get a new, more "powerful" NFT. While it looked like a great innovation and interesting gamified mint where you could spend $JIRA to reroll your fused jiras at the mint, I think it was a bad move in the long term. It overcomplicated the ecosystem, making many people not understand how the PG collections worked. Artwise, the Fusions got mixed reactions. JIRAVERSE [4/10]: Maybe the biggest fumble from @JirasanOfficial. Again, great vision and innovative thinking. Create an NFT collection that incorporates 3 NFTs in one with stage reveals. The mint was a stellar experience - the first stage was to reveal Jiravoxels - a bet on the metaverse (let's not go there). The art and implementation were great, but there was one big issue - the NFT bear market arrived, and phases two and three were abandoned. We will probably never know what magical treasures lay behind those phases. Kudos to the team for acknowledging the fuck up and refunding all diamond hands. DEADJIRA [8/10]: Enter the ordinals hype—sub 100k ordinal collection with a supply of 100. Few were able to mint at a price of 1ETH. The art is spot on; the ATH sale was at 0.4 BTC! It's a collector's item - go now and get one for cheap so your children can be proud of you in 30 years. ORDINAL WAR [7.5/10]: Another sub-100k ordinal collection that innovated the mint process. You bought ETH nfts that would be bridged to the $BTC chain later. The PG ordinal team led by @shin_raton gave an early investment opportunity in a hyped new tech. The ones who believed managed to get much value out of it. SPITBUDDIES [3/10]: This should have been a lesson for @JirasanOfficial to choose partners more carefully. In this space, reputation is hard-earned but easily lost. RIP @Llamaverse_ $BTOC [9.5/10] Yes, you read it right. I'm giving almost a perfect score for the brc20 launch of PG. While the tech faded into oblivion, the team delivered an incredibly professional launch. The marketing was spot on. When it came to the mint day, it was a complete disaster at first because things were overcomplicated for no reason. The hired devs had to implement payments in SOL, BTC, and ETH—a total failure. Usually, a botched mint means game over, but PG is made of materials not found on Earth. A few days later, everything was fully minted using a different dev team. I have not seen such a recovery in my web3 career, hence my almost perfect rating. JIRASAN [10/10]: Consolidating all collections into a single 10k one. Complex task communication and a lot of technical challenges. The art was a big question mark. It turned out great and is one of the best in the space.
